BENGALURU (Reuters) -Indian shares opened lower on Wednesday, dragged by financials and energy stocks, amid concerns over a sharp rise in July domestic inflation.
The Nifty 50 index was down 0.58% at 19,324.55 while the S&P BSE Sensex fell 0.46% to 65,112.70 at 9:16 a.m. IST.
